What is a motherboard and what does it contain
The largest circuitry board inside the computer which contains things like
the CPU, the BIOS, the bus, the memory, ports, and CMOS.
What is the BIOS
This is the basic input or output system
which has simple sets of instructions for the computer. It is used during the startup process of the computer and runs diagnostics for functioning. It oversees functioning of the computer.
What is the bus
The bus provides the connections for the information to flow within the computer.

What is a port on a computer
The computers ports are a collection of connectors out of the back of the PC that link cards, drives, printers, scanners, keyboards, mice and other devices.
What is a parallel port?
A 25 pin connector synonymous with the printer port. It can send 8 Bits of data through each connection
What is a Serial port
Mostly of the nine pin variety but can have up to 25 pin connectors and can only send one bit of data down a single wire.
What is the most common wired connection used between devices
The USB connection
What is the CMOS
A special type of memory chip that uses a small rechargeable or lithium battery to retain information about the PC’s Hardware while the computer is turned off
What is the power supply
The power supply delivers all electricity to the PC and contains a fan to keep the computer cool
What is the hard drive
The hard drive is the main repository for programs and documents on a PC made of many hard thin magnetic platters stacked on top of the other

What is screen resolution
Number of pixels on a screen
What is dot pitch
The meazurement of how close the dots are located to one anothet within a pixel
What is a dot tried
The makeup of a pixel. A grouping of a red dot, green dot, and blue dot.
What is the refresh rate
How fast the monitor rewrites the screen
